Transaction 576d84230883c87249030e9955374d35f3b2f7fd8d6b252bc5756f923ad57496

1 Input
2 Outputs
  • 576d84230883c87249030e9955374d35f3b2f7fd8d6b252bc5756f923ad57496:0
  • value  2382317
    address  17tNeReCqB1yC9Syw8L8sZkh3vc9afdDUJ
  • 576d84230883c87249030e9955374d35f3b2f7fd8d6b252bc5756f923ad57496:1
  • value  116049189
    address  1DBE7RZt4xon9Dqfirz5usAE7Rjkbv4zEf